Summary: The Supreme Court dismissed M/S. M.V. Constructions' Special Leave Petition challenging the High Court of Karnataka's judgment dated 03-02-2026, finding no good ground to interfere with the impugned order. All pending applications have been disposed of, and the matter concludes with no further directions or next hearings scheduled.
